The doses of Moderna vaccine arrived on Wednesday morning at the National Institute for Medical-Military Research-Development “Cantacuzino”, and in the next period will be distributed in the regional vaccination centers, informs the Ministry of National Defense.
“The first tranche, of 14,000 doses of Moderna vaccine, entered Romania last night. The doses arrived this morning at the National Institute for Medical-Military Research-Development ‘Cantacuzino’, and in the next period will be distributed in the regional vaccination centers “, writes MApN, on its Facebook page.
The first tranche of the Moderna vaccine arrived, on Tuesday evening, in Romania, by land, through the Nădlac II Border Crossing Point.
